520 _aA psychological historical novel set across the eighteenth century and the 1990s, inspired by the real Painshill Park in Surrey, England. The narrative explores the ambitions of its creator, Charles Hamilton, alongside a fictionalized account of his first wife’s mysterious disappearance. Blending history and imagination, the novel examines themes of obsession, legacy, and hidden histories.
